Are viral traffic’s days numbered?

It may seem like the Internet was awash in posts about #thedress and, for that matter, runaway llamas, as of late. But a confluence of factors, from viewability to changing Facebook algorithms to falling CPMs, are making the economics of this kind of viral strategy a bit more complicated. "There's absolute pressure on publishers to weed that stuff out. Nobody wants junk traffic on their plan," said Horizon Media's Maikel O'Hanlon.
